Bengals Superfan’s Apparel Brand Blows Up After Cincinnati QB Joe Burrow Wears T-shirt to Game

Before the season, Ace Boogie sent a T-shirt he designed to three Cincinnati Bengals wide receivers and quarterback Joe Burrow. Months later, Burrow wore the shirt to the stadium for a game against the Kansas City Chiefs, and pictures of Burrow in the shirt made the rounds on social media. The Bengals won 34-31 to clinch the division, and, suddenly, everybody had to have one of the shirts…

How One Promo Distributor Created Natural Light Vodka’s Custom Trapper Hat (That Holds Miniature Bottles of Alcohol)

Natural Light released a line of flavored vodka last year. To make sure patrons stay warm, the brand is selling a trapper hat that not only insulates your noggin during these cold winter months, but also stores little bottles of vodka to make sure you’re wearing your alcohol blanket in case you venture out into the tundra. The promo distributor behind the hat told us how it all came together…

Manchester City Partners With Heineken for ‘Plastics’ Statue Outside Stadium

Manchester City, a club that grew from lower-league irrelevance to one of the biggest soccer clubs in the world, is trying to eradicate “plastics” (i.e., frontrunning fans) from the club as well as the environment through a partnership with Heineken that involves two life-sized statues of literal plastic fans made from recycled plastic waste outside Etihad Stadium…

Target Marketing Group Appoints Rob Ross as Chief Operating Officer

Target Marketing Group announced last week that the company has appointed Rob Ross as chief operating officer. He will assume day-to-day leadership of the company. John Leahy, president and founder of Target Marketing Group, will continue to serve as CEO. Before joining TMG, Ross spent two years at HALO in a senior management role as president of HALO Detroit…

Ubisoft Lets Gamers Turn In-Game Screenshots Into Custom Merch

Using the photo mode in games like “Assassin’s Creed Valhalla,” players can capture moments and then use Ubisoft’s partnership with Zakeke to add them to items like T-shirts, hoodies, mugs, phone cases and more. And like every social media platform these days, there are editing capabilities like filters, sizing tools and more…
